Feiler discloses a proximal cement sealing plug for a hip prosthesis. The sealing plug 2 is shown in Figures 10 and 11. The hip prosthesis is shown in Figure 14. Figure 17 shows the hip prosthesis and sealing plug implanted in the proximal femur. The appellants argue (brief, pp. 6-8, and reply brief, pp. 1-3) that Feiler does not disclose the recited "seal means" since the structure of Feiler cannot prevent leaking of cement therefrom during implantation of the prosthesis. Specifically, the appellants point out that Feiler lacks any structure equivalent to their resilient rear seal member 55. We agree. The examiner's position (examiner's answer to reply brief, p. 2) that the seal member 55 is not part of the claimed subject matter because it is a separate piece used in combination with the prosthesis 10 is unpersuasive for the following reasons.
